Optimisation des performances de votre boutique PrestaShop
Si la rapidité de votre boutique vous permet d’apporter du confort à vos utilisateurs, elle est aussi importante pour vos conversions et votre visibilité. En référencement naturel, la performance technique fait partie des 3 piliers fondamentaux. Avoir un site lent, c’est donc perdre des ventes, mais aussi des positions sur son SEO.
Aujourd’hui, les moteurs de recherche intègrent à la fois la performance de votre boutique et l’expérience utilisateur dans les critères de classement. Les Core Web Vitals (LCP, FID et CLS) vous permettent de mesurer ces performances, ils indiquent si vos pages se chargent vite, réagissent correctement et restent stables visuellement. De mauvais scores peuvent freiner votre progression SEO, tandis que de bonnes performances renforcent votre potentiel de visibilité.
Bonne nouvelle ! Optimiser une boutique PrestaShop n’est pas forcément le plus complexe. Avec les bons leviers, il est possible d’identifier rapidement les points à améliorer, à la fois sur la vitesse, le référencement et la rentabilité. Dans ce guide, nous allons passer en revue les principaux freins aux performances de votre boutique et les optimisations à mettre en place.
Comprendre les Core Web Vitals : où les trouver et quoi analyser ?
Avant de lancer toute optimisation, il faut analyser les performances de votre boutique. Chez ARPA3, nous nous appuyons sur 3 outils principalement :
- Google Search Console : offre une vision globale du site et permet d’identifier les pages problématiques en termes de vitesse et d’expérience utilisateur, avec des données issues des visiteurs.
- Google PageSpeed Insight : génère des rapports sur l’expérience utilisateur d’une page à la fois sur mobile et sur ordinateur et suggère des améliorations possibles.
- GTmetrix : fournit une analyse technique détaillée, mesure le temps de chargement et identifie les causes de lenteur.



Qu’est-ce que les Core Web Vitals ?
Les Core Web Vitals sont trois mesures qui permettent de savoir si votre site offre une bonne expérience à vos visiteurs :
- Largest Contentful Paint (LCP) : c’est le temps que met le contenu principal (texte, image ou bannière) à s’afficher.
Objectif : moins de 2,5 secondes.
Impact : plus le LCP est rapide, plus vos visiteurs perçoivent votre site comme rapide et agréable. - First Input Delay (FID) : c’est le temps que met le site à réagir quand un utilisateur clique, scrolle ou tape sur un bouton.
Objectif : moins de 100 ms.
Impact : un FID faible rend la navigation fluide et évite la frustration. - Cumulative Layout Shift (CLS) : c’est la stabilité visuelle d’une page pendant le chargement.
Objectif : moins de 0,1.
Impact : si les éléments bougent pendant le chargement, le CLS est élevé et cela peut faire fuir vos visiteurs.
En résumé, les Core Web Vitals vous montrent où votre boutique PrestaShop est lente, réagit mal ou est instable. Les comprendre est la première étape de l’optimisation PrestaShop pour améliorer vitesse, expérience utilisateur et SEO.
5 optimisations pour optimiser vos performances sur PrestaShop
1. Optimiser les images
Les images constituent souvent la partie la plus lourde d’une page et peuvent fortement ralentir votre boutique si elles ne sont pas optimisées correctement.
Solutions :
- Compresser les images avant importation.
- Utiliser un module de compression automatique.
- Privilégier le format WebP pour réduire le poids.
- Activer le lazy loading pour charger les images uniquement quand nécessaire.
Bonnes pratiques : quel poid pour vos images ?
- Photos produits (JPEG / WebP) : Idéalement entre 80 et 200 Ko
- Images avec transparence (PNG / WebP) : Idéalement entre 50 et 150 Ko
- Icônes, logos, pictogrammes (SVG) : Idéalement moins de 20 Ko
- Bannières et images de slider : Idéalement entre 150 et 400 Ko
2. Configurer le cache PrestaShop
Le cache permet de stocker des versions pré-générées de vos pages afin d’accélérer l’affichage pour vos visiteurs.
Solutions :
- Activez le cache natif depuis le back-office (Paramètres avancés > Performance).
- Utiliser un cache serveur.
- Activez la mise en cache des templates, du CSS et du JavaScript.
Bonnes pratiques :
- Purgez le cache après chaque mise à jour d’un module, du thème ou d’un contenu critique.
- Testez votre site en navigation privée après une purge pour vérifier que les modifications s’affichent correctement.
- Surveillez régulièrement vos performances (TTFB / temps serveur) afin de détecter si un cache est mal configuré.
- Évitez d’installer plusieurs modules de cache simultanément, ce qui peut créer des conflits et ralentir le site.
3. Optimiser le code et réduire les requêtes
Un site avec trop de fichiers, de scripts ou de fonctionnalités inutiles met plus de temps à se charger, ce qui ralentit l’affichage des pages et dégrade l’expérience utilisateur.
Solutions :
- Activez la minification pour réduire automatiquement la taille des fichiers (CSS, JavaScript, HTML).
- Chargez certains scripts seulement quand c’est nécessaire.
- Supprimez les modules ou fonctionnalités inutilisés.
Bonnes pratiques :
- Testez votre site après chaque changement pour vérifier que tout fonctionne.
- Priorisez le contenu visible au-dessus de la page (images, textes, boutons principaux).
- Limitez les fichiers ou bibliothèques trop lourds si vous n’en avez pas besoin.
4. Choisir un hébergement rapide
L’hébergement est comme la fondation de votre boutique : si le serveur est lent, tout le reste le sera aussi
Solutions :
- Privilégiez un serveur dédié ou VPS pour les boutiques à fort trafic.
- Choisissez un hébergeur proche de vos clients.
- Utilisez un CDN pour un chargement rapide des fichiers et images.
Chez ARPA3, nous accompagnons nos clients sur ces choix avec nos partenaires 77/2424
Bonnes pratiques :
- Vérifiez régulièrement que votre hébergeur offre de bonnes performances.
- Assurez-vous que votre site est compatible avec les dernières versions de PHP (le langage utilisé par PrestaShop).
- Optimisez votre base de données si votre boutique est ancienne ou très fournie. Pour cela, identifier les données obsolètes et supprimez les (anciens logs, paniers, codes promos expirés, etc.).
5. Limiter les ressources externes
Certains outils externes (polices, trackers, chat, widgets) peuvent ralentir votre site car ils dépendent de serveurs tiers.
Solutions :
- Hébergez vos polices et fichiers essentiels en local sur votre site.
- Supprimez les scripts ou outils non indispensables.
- Chargez certains outils seulement quand l’utilisateur interagit.
Bonnes pratiques :
- Limitez le nombre de polices et de variantes typographiques.
- Évitez de cumuler plusieurs outils qui font la même chose (analytics, chat, tests A/B…).
- Vérifiez régulièrement les scripts qui se chargent sur vos pages.
Pourquoi optimiser sa boutique est un levier stratégique ?
Améliorer la vitesse de votre boutique vous permet de booster votre chiffre d’affaires et votre référencement. Un site rapide rend vos visiteurs heureux, facilite leurs achats et augmente vos conversions.
Pour résumer :
- Optimisez vos images et utilisez le lazy loading.
- Activez et configurez correctement le cache PrestaShop.
- Allégez votre code et supprimez les modules inutiles.
- Choisissez un hébergement performant et un CDN si nécessaire.
- Limitez les scripts et ressources externes qui ralentissent le site.
Vous avez détecté des problématiques de performances sur votre site ?
Vous avez fait le nécessaire mais vos performances n’augmentent pas ?
Vous ne savez pas par quel bout commencer pour booster les performances de votre boutique ?
Identifiez rapidement vos axes d’amélioration grâce à notre audit e-commerce gratuit, incluant une analyse des performances de votre boutique et des recommandations pour accélérer votre croissance en ligne.